NCTC Founding President Passes
NCTC founding president Mike Pandzik passed away Monday after battling cancer for several months. He led the co-op for 21 years, growing the organization from originally 12 operator members to more than 1,100 when he retired in 2005. News of his passing came as NCTC completed its board meeting Tuesday.

Obituary
Doug McCormick, a cable veteran who rose to CEO of Lifetime TV Networksand launched Lifetime Movie Network, passed away Monday after a 17-year battle with a rare form of cancer.
